In the world of fishing gear, the Abu Garcia Zenon MG-X Casting Reel has set a new standard for performance and quality. Winner of the 'Best Overall Casting Reel of 2025' following rigorous testing against 32 other models, the Zenon MG-X's standout features have captured the attention of anglers everywhere.
"The MG-X was the clear winner," said Shaye Baker, a seasoned angler who evaluated the reel amidst a competitive landscape. He expressed his satisfaction, stating, "I like this reel so much that it's become my go-to casting reel for almost any situation."

The Zenon MG-X weighs an impressive 5.1 ounces and comes in two gear ratios: 6.8:1 and 8.3:1. It is equipped with 10 stainless steel ball bearings, ensuring a smooth retrieve that enhances the fishing experience. "The reel is built on a one-piece X-Mag alloy frame […] making this one of the lightest yet strongest reels available today," Baker noted, emphasizing its durability and lightweight design.

Despite its premium price tag, with models starting at $370 for left-handed retrieves and $470 for right-handed, many anglers find value in its composite build and performance. However, Baker acknowledges this investment is not for everyone: "Sure, other baitcasters can get the job done at half the price, but if you’re looking for the absolute best casting reel on the market, the Zenon MG-X is it."

The reel features a Carbon Matrix Drag System, designed to withstand significant pressure. "This reel can handle any bass you may encounter, whether a double-digit Texas largemouth or an 8-pound Great Lakes bronzeback," Baker explained. This strength allows anglers to switch confidently between techniques, from finesse fishing to power tactics, without sacrificing performance.

Anglers frequently associate the Zenon MG-X with finesse-style baits, but Baker has discovered its versatility. "Although the MG-X is designed to cast lightweight baits—which it does extremely well—I’ve gone the opposite way with it," he shared. He utilizes the reel for heavier techniques, spooling it with 40-pound Sufix 832 braid for added confidence.

"I love to throw swim jigs and spinnerbaits with this reel, and I don’t hesitate to lay into hooksets with it," Baker elaborated. His first-hand experience reflects that the Zenon MG-X supports aggressive fishing styles just as well as nuanced techniques, making it adaptable in various fishing contexts.

Comfort is also a significant aspect of the Zenon MG-X. Its low-profile design and comfortable EVA handles stand out, contributing to a more enjoyable experience during prolonged use.
